Book a CallThe Maple Syrup Market in 2026
The global maple syrup market reached roughly $1.64 billion in 2025 and is tracked to reach $1.75 billion in 2026, according to Fortune Business Insights. North America produces the overwhelming majority of the world's supply, and the industry's growth story is less about new demand and more about a structural supply ceiling: you cannot tap more trees than you own or lease, and the trees that produce the best sap take decades to mature.
On the production side, the US crop came in at 5.7 million gallons in 2025, down only slightly from 5.8 million gallons the year before, according to The Maple News, citing USDA figures. Vermont alone produced 3.06 million gallons from 8.35 million taps at a yield of 0.367 gallons per tap, according to the Vermont Agency of Agriculture, Food & Markets. New York (829,000 gallons), Wisconsin (556,000 gallons) and Maine (549,000 gallons) trail well behind.
The single most important structural fact a new producer needs to plan around is Quebec's quota system. Quebec's roughly 13,500 producers, organised under the Quebec Maple Syrup Producers federation (PPAQ), supply about 94% of Canadian output and 77% of the world's syrup. The PPAQ runs a mandatory quota: producers who exceed their annual allocation route the surplus into the Global Strategic Maple Syrup Reserve, and in a weak year they can draw against it. Because Quebec supplies most of the world's bulk syrup, that reserve effectively sets the floor price a US wholesale buyer will offer a new producer, whether or not that producer has ever heard of the PPAQ. This is a market-structure risk most generic farm business plan templates never mention, and it belongs in your competitive analysis section, not just your appendix.
For a UK reader, the picture is different again. Commercial-scale production doesn't happen domestically: the UK climate can't support sugar maple stands at production scale, so nearly all maple syrup on UK shelves is imported from the US and Canada. A UK-based plan in this space is usually built around import and distribution, or around a small novelty batch made from sycamore or birch sap, which yields a lower-sugar, differently flavoured product at a fraction of the volume. If that's your angle, say so explicitly in your plan's executive summary rather than borrowing US production assumptions wholesale.
Climate Risk & Regional Yield Differences
Almost no generic business plan template mentions this, and it belongs in your risk section: the geography of maple production is shifting under producers' feet. Research summarised by the USDA Climate Hubs projects that New York's sap season will move 15 to 30 days earlier by the end of the century as the freeze-thaw cycle that triggers sap flow shifts with warmer winters. A separate study tracked in peer-reviewed research on eastern Canada found that sap sugar content declines by about 0.1 Brix for every 1°C rise in the prior May-through-October temperature, and that the zone of maximum sap flow is expected to shift roughly 400 kilometres north by 2100, from near the 43rd parallel toward the 48th. A recent producer survey found that 89% of maple operators nationwide have already experienced negative production-season impacts from a warming climate.
This matters directly for where you site a new operation and how you underwrite risk in a funding application. Producers at the southern edge of the maple range (Ohio, Pennsylvania, Maryland, parts of southern Wisconsin) are underwriting a longer-term suitability question that Vermont, Quebec and Maine operations are not yet facing to the same degree. It's a legitimate line item for a lender or investor to ask about, and a plan that addresses it directly reads as more credible than one that doesn't mention it at all.
Regional yield also varies more than most first-time producers expect, and it isn't just about weather in a single season. Wisconsin posted the highest yield per tap in the country at 0.408 gallons per tap in 2023, well ahead of New York's 0.291 gallons per tap in 2022 and Vermont's 0.367 gallons per tap in 2025. Tubing type, vacuum use, tree age and stand density all move that number independently of climate, which is why a business plan should model yield per tap as a range tied to your specific equipment plan rather than borrowing a single national average. On pricing, the 2025 US average price per gallon reached $35.60, up $1.40 from 2024, which sits between the bulk-drum and bottled-retail figures cited earlier because it blends both channels across every producer in the national data set.

How much sap does it actually take to make a gallon of syrup?
Roughly 40 gallons of raw sap boil down to one gallon of finished syrup at typical sugar content, though this swings with the tree's Brix (sugar percentage): a 3.0 Brix tree needs less sap per gallon than a 2.0 Brix tree, which is why yield-per-tap varies so much between regions and even between trees on the same lot.
What's the real difference between Grade A and the old Grade B syrup?
The USDA's 2015 grade rewrite eliminated Grade B entirely. Everything is now Grade A, split into four colour classes measured by spectrophotometer (Golden, Amber, Dark, Very Dark), with a separate "Processing Grade" for syrup destined for further manufacturing rather than retail. If your plan still references "Grade B," a lender or grant reviewer will notice the plan is out of date.
Can I sell sap without boiling it at all?
Yes, and extension research suggests it's the most profitable channel per tap in a strong season: selling raw sap directly to a buyer with their own evaporator avoids fuel, equipment and labour costs entirely, at the cost of a lower price per gallon-equivalent. Many multi-generation operations blend sap sales with finished syrup precisely to smooth out a season where sugar content runs low.
Does Quebec's reserve affect me if I'm producing in Vermont or New York?
Indirectly, yes. Because Quebec supplies the large majority of the world's bulk syrup, the price the reserve defends becomes the reference price US wholesale buyers use when negotiating contracts with US producers, even though US producers aren't part of the PPAQ quota system themselves.
Startup Costs & Funding Options
Startup capital for a maple operation scales almost linearly with tap count and how much of the collection and boiling process you automate. A lean operation with gravity tubing and a small wood-fired evaporator can launch for around $50,000. A mid-scale operation with reverse osmosis pre-concentration and a proper sugarhouse building typically needs $150,000. A large operation running vacuum tubing across several thousand taps, with a commercial evaporator and full bottling line, can reach $500,000. In the UK, where commercial sugarbush production isn't viable, a hobby or novelty small-batch setup typically runs £15,000–£60,000.
Cost Breakdown
- Sugarbush tubing/collection system: $18–$25 per tap installed, scaling with the 900–3,800 taps needed to reach breakeven
- Evaporator + arch (Leader, Dominion & Grimm, CDL, Lapierre): $8,000–$120,000 depending on rig size
- Reverse osmosis pre-concentration unit: $6,000–$45,000 — cuts boiling time and fuel cost dramatically at scale
- Sugarhouse building + fit-out: $15,000–$150,000 (£5,000–£30,000 for a converted farm outbuilding in the UK)
- Bottling, labelling & USDA-grade filtration/hydrometers: $3,000–$18,000
- Vacuum pump system (larger tubing networks only): $5,000–$35,000
- Working capital to bridge the gap between a spring boil and autumn wholesale contract payments: $10,000–$60,000
Funding Routes
Because maple sap reduction is classified under NAICS 111998 ("All Other Miscellaneous Crop Farming"), most producers are routed toward USDA Farm Service Agency (FSA) financing rather than the SBA 7(a) programme most other small businesses use, since FSA is the government's designated lender of last resort for agricultural operations. Two FSA products matter most here: the Farm Storage Facility Loan, which explicitly names maple sap and maple syrup as eligible commodities for on-farm storage and handling financing, and the Beginning Farmer and Microloan programmes, which offer up to $50,000 with lighter collateral requirements for operators in their first ten years. In the UK, there's no equivalent agricultural-scale programme for this niche; a novelty producer typically self-funds or uses a general small-business start-up loan. Buy vs. Lease a Sugarbush
Most first-time producers assume they need to own the land outright, but a sugarbush lease (sometimes called a "sugaring lease" or "tap lease") is common practice in Vermont, New York and Quebec, especially where a landowner has mature maples but no interest in running the boiling operation themselves. A typical lease pays the landowner either a flat annual fee per tap or a small percentage of finished syrup revenue, and it can cut your day-one capital requirement by removing land purchase entirely from the funding ask. The trade-off is contract length: because sugar maples take decades to mature and a tubing installation is a multi-year capital investment, lenders and equipment financiers will usually want to see a lease term of at least 10-15 years before they'll finance tubing or an evaporator against leased land. If your plan assumes a short-term lease, expect financing questions about what happens to the tubing and evaporator investment if the lease isn't renewed.
Insurance: What It Actually Costs
Most farmers-market-scale and small direct-to-consumer producers pay $200-$500 a year for a combined general liability and product liability policy through a food-specific insurer, according to pricing published by the Food Liability Insurance Program (FLIP). Most farmers markets and specialty grocers require $1 million per occurrence and $2 million aggregate coverage before they'll let you sell through them, so check that minimum against your chosen policy rather than assuming a cheaper basic liability plan will satisfy a venue's contract. Rates climb with revenue, the number of selling locations, and any prior claims history, so build a modest annual increase into your five-year forecast rather than holding the premium flat.
Named Equipment Suppliers
Unlike a lot of small-business categories, maple equipment is dominated by a handful of manufacturers whose names you should know before you price out a rig, because dealer quotes will reference them directly.
- Leader Evaporator Company — one of the oldest US evaporator and arch manufacturers; a common reference point for wood-fired and oil-fired rigs from hobby scale up to commercial
- Dominion & Grimm — Quebec-based manufacturer of evaporators, reverse osmosis units and vacuum systems, widely used on both sides of the US-Canada border
- CDL — reverse osmosis and vacuum equipment specialist, frequently paired with Leader or Dominion & Grimm evaporators on mid-to-large rigs
- Lapierre — tubing, tanks and evaporator manufacturer, another Quebec-rooted brand common in cross-border equipment lists
- Bascom Maple Farms (Alstead, NH) — one of the largest producers and equipment dealers in New England; also a useful benchmark for aggregator/co-op pricing if you plan to sell bulk rather than build a retail brand
- Fuller's Sugarhouse and regional dealers such as Russell Maple Farms — authorised distributors that combine several of the above manufacturer lines under one dealer relationship, useful if you want a single quote rather than sourcing evaporator, RO and tubing separately
On the finished-goods side, four brand names are worth studying regardless of your own scale: Crown Maple (Hudson Valley, NY) built a premium estate-grown positioning that commands retail prices well above commodity syrup; Runamok (Vermont) took a chef-driven approach with barrel-aged and infused variants; Butternut Mountain Farm (Vermont) has spent over 40 years aggregating small-farm syrup under one retail label; and Coombs Family Farms runs a cooperative model across roughly 3,000 small New England farms. If your plan's differentiation section says "we'll sell high-quality syrup," look at which of these four models you're actually closest to, because the go-to-market and margin structure are very different between an estate brand and a co-op aggregator.
On the practical side of sourcing: most regional dealers who carry Leader, Dominion & Grimm, CDL or Lapierre equipment can turn around a full-rig quote (evaporator, RO unit, tubing package) within one to two weeks, and several offer manufacturer or dealer financing on larger equipment packages, which is worth comparing against an FSA loan's terms before you commit to one financing route. Get quotes for the exact tap count and yield assumptions in your business plan rather than a generic "starter package," since evaporator and RO sizing is driven directly by how many gallons of sap you expect to process per hour during peak flow, not by tap count alone.
Revenue Model & Real Unit Economics
Maple syrup has three distinct revenue channels, and most new producers only plan around one of them. Bulk/wholesale drums sell for roughly $2.10–$2.25 per pound, which works out to about $23–$25 per gallon. Retail bottled syrup, sold direct or through a specialty grocer, commands $50–$60 per gallon. And raw, unboiled sap sold directly to a buyer with their own evaporator can bring in $10 or more per tap in a strong season, without any fuel, equipment or labour cost on your side.
Cost of production is where most templates fall apart, because they quote one number instead of showing how it changes with scale. University of Vermont and USDA Forest Service research puts the weighted average at $11.48 per gallon (roughly $2.87 per tap, at four taps required per gallon). A 500-tap hobby-scale operation runs closer to $6.47 per tap because fixed costs (evaporator fuel, insurance, labour) aren't spread over enough volume. A 10,000-tap operation cuts that down to about $2.56 per tap through scale.
Worked Example
A 2,000-tap operation at a 0.30 gallon-per-tap yield produces 600 gallons in a season. Selling 70% wholesale in bulk drums at $24/gallon generates $10,080; selling the remaining 30% direct-to-consumer in bottles at $55/gallon generates $9,900 — a combined $19,980 in revenue. Against a production cost of roughly $4 per tap at this scale ($8,000) plus bottling, labelling and fuel (about $3,500), that clears close to a 42% gross margin before owner labour and equipment depreciation. This is exactly why extension economists put the real breakeven point at 900–3,800 taps rather than a flat dollar figure: below that range, the fixed costs simply outweigh what the syrup sells for, no matter how good the sap is.
A well-maintained vacuum tubing system can increase sap yield per tap by 50–100% compared to gravity buckets, which is usually the single highest-leverage capital upgrade an operation below 2,000 taps can make. Producers who convert from buckets to tubing in year two typically see their per-tap cost curve shift meaningfully by year three, which is the assumption baked into the worked example above.
Planning Cash Flow Around a 4-8 Week Season
The single biggest financial-planning mistake in this niche isn't a pricing error, it's a cash-flow timing error. Nearly all of a maple operation's revenue arrives in a 4-8 week spring boil window, while equipment maintenance, insurance, land costs and any loan repayments run year-round. A plan that shows flat monthly revenue, or that assumes wholesale buyers pay on delivery rather than on a 30-60 day invoice cycle, will not survive scrutiny from an FSA loan officer or a private lender. Build the cash-flow schedule around actual harvest timing for your region (typically February-April in the northern US and Quebec, compressed to a narrower window as far south as Ohio and Pennsylvania), and hold enough working capital to cover the seven-to-nine month gap between the end of one boil and the start of the next.

Licensing: US, UK & Canada
United States
- State food producer or maple license — requirements vary by state; Minnesota, for example, requires a license to sell to the public unless every drop of sap comes from the producer's own land with no off-farm inputs, and most other maple states run a similar own-land exemption
- USDA AMS grading — voluntary, not mandatory; the 2015 rewrite replaced Grade B with four Grade A colour classes measured by spectrophotometer, plus a separate Processing Grade
- FSA loan compliance documentation — required only if you use Farm Storage Facility Loan or Microloan financing
- Food facility registration for any operation that bottles and sells across state lines
- Commercial general liability + product liability insurance — near-universal requirement for wholesale contracts
United Kingdom
- Register the food business with your local Environmental Health Department at least 28 days before trading
- Comply with HACCP-based food safety rules under the Food Safety Act 1990 and retained EU Regulation 852/2004
- Meet UK food labelling regulations covering ingredients, allergens and nutritional declarations
- Register for VAT once turnover crosses the £85,000 threshold
- Pursue UK Organic Standards certification only if you intend to market the product as organic
- Because domestic sugar maple production isn't commercially viable, most UK operators in this space are importers/distributors or small sycamore/birch-sap novelty producers — build your licensing checklist around the model you're actually running
Canada (Quebec)
Quebec producers selling in bulk operate inside the PPAQ's mandatory quota system: each producer is assigned an annual sales allocation, surplus above quota is routed into the Global Strategic Maple Syrup Reserve, and shortfall years let producers draw against it. This single-buyer structure, covering roughly 13,500 producers and 77% of world supply, is worth understanding even if you're producing in Vermont or New York, because it effectively sets the reference price your own wholesale contracts will be negotiated against.
Six Mistakes That Sink New Producers
None of these are exotic; they're the same handful of errors extension agents and equipment dealers see repeated every season, usually because a first-time producer's plan never priced in the mistake as a real cost.
- Picking trees in late winter instead of summer. Canopy condition, which tells you whether a tree is healthy enough to tap well, is only visible when the leaves are out. Producers who mark their sugarbush in summer tap healthier trees and get better sap flow.
- Overdriving the spile. A snug tap is enough; hammering it in cracks the bark, reduces sap flow, and can permanently damage the tree's ability to heal and produce in future seasons.
- Leaving an underperforming tap in place. A slow tap won't improve on its own. The standard fix is to re-tap a fresh hole at least 6 inches from the old one rather than waiting out the season on reduced flow.
- Ignoring off-flavour risk. Budded sap (collected too late in the season) and delayed boiling are the two most common causes of off-flavour syrup that can't be sold at Grade A prices, and sometimes can't be sold retail at all.
- Planning around bottled retail pricing only. Sap-only wholesale can be the highest-margin channel per tap in a strong season, since it skips fuel, equipment and labour costs entirely. A plan that ignores it is leaving a real revenue lever unmodelled.
- Undercapitalising the first three seasons. Extension research puts breakeven at 900–3,800 taps depending on sap sugar content; producers who launch below that range without enough working capital to survive two or three seasons of thin margins are the ones who don't make it to year five.
Maple Syrup Glossary: 8 Terms Worth Knowing
Reviewers, lenders and equipment dealers will use this vocabulary as shorthand. Knowing it cold makes your plan read as credible on the first page rather than the fifth.
- Sugarbush — the stand of maple trees an operation taps for sap; the term describes the land asset itself, not the finished product
- Spile (tap) — the small spout driven into a drilled hole in the tree that directs sap into tubing or a bucket
- Brix — the percentage of sugar in sap or finished syrup; higher Brix sap needs fewer gallons boiled down per gallon of syrup, which is why yield per tap varies so much by tree and region
- Reverse osmosis (RO) — a membrane filtration step that removes water from raw sap before boiling, cutting fuel use and boil time dramatically on any operation above a few hundred taps
- Arch — the firebox or furnace beneath an evaporator pan that supplies the heat used to boil sap down into syrup
- Vacuum tubing — a tubing network connected to a vacuum pump that actively pulls sap from the tree rather than relying on gravity, typically increasing yield per tap by 50-100%
- Hydrometer — the tool used to confirm finished syrup has reached the correct density (up to 68.9% Brix for Grade A) before it's bottled
- Sugarhouse — the building that houses the evaporator, RO unit and bottling line; the physical hub of the operation during the spring boil
